Infrared thermal cores and lenses
When building an infrared imaging solution, components such as thermal imaging cores and lenses have multiple features that need to be considered before selecting the right one for your individual application.
Each core has different qualities that need to be prioritised depending on your specific requirements. Important considerations include the overall weight of the core, size, pixel pitch, thermal sensitivity, and mounting capability. Once you have identified the right core, it can be combined with a selection of thermal lenses to best suit your needs.
